Leavitt remained as the team's head coach throughout this period. He was fired on January 8, 2010 after an investigation revealed that during halftime of a game against Louisville, he grabbed a player by the shoulder pads and struck him across the face two times. The investigation also claimed that Leavitt interfered with the investigation by telling several coaches and players to change their stories
http://www.usf.edu/pdf/Enclosure-1-Leavitt-Review-Final.pdf. Leavitt maintains he never struck the player, but was merely trying to console him, and is currently suing USF.

is a $168.5 million facility which opened September 20, 1998 with a Tampa Bay Buccaneers game against the Chicago Bears. Two weeks later, the Bulls debuted in their new home with a 45-6 win over Citadel in front of 32,598 fans. From 1998 to 2007, only the lower half of the stadium has been typically opened for USF games, allowing for a capacity of 41,441, (although the upper deck has been opened numerous times to accommodate crowds in excess of what the lower bowl can handle). However, as of 2008, USF has opened the upper deck for every home game and is selling season tickets in the upper deck as well. The largest crowd to see the Bulls play a home game came on September 28, 2007 against then #5 ranked West Virginia, when 67,012 saw the #18 Bulls win. The Bulls played at

Due to the youth of the program and the aggressive growth that it has experienced, establishing a permanent rival has posed somewhat of a challenge. Rapidly changing conference affiliations and a quick ascension through the NCAA football ranks have made an annual rivalry difficult. On the heels of upsets that have garnered national attention, the seeds of rivalry have been planted with powers such as Louisville and West Virginia. - USF rose at an unprecedented pace, earning an AP ranking 104 polls after becoming a full-time, bowl eligible FBS member in 2001. Boise State
This page discusses the Boise State football program. For more Boise State athletics, see Boise State Broncos.The Boise State Broncos football program represents Boise State University in college football and compete in the Football Bowl Subdivision of Division I as a member of the Mountain West...
had the previous record, getting ranked after 115 AP polls during their seventh season.
- USF became the fastest team in the modern era of college football to go from upstart NCAA FBS school to a top-10 ranking on Sunday, Sept. 30. There were 106 AP polls and 112 Coaches Polls since USF became a full-time FBS member in 2001.
- The same can be said about the top-5 ranking, which took USF 107 weeks to achieve.
